Join Aprio's Audit team and you will help clients maximize their opportunities. Aprio Advisory Group, LLC is a progressive, fast-growing firm looking for an Audit Manager, Manufacturing & Distribution to join their dynamic team.
Responsibilities:
-
Conducting multiple auditing projects and client engagements.
-
Effectively communicating with partners, staff and clients regarding expectations, status of engagements and other matters
-
Preparation of financial statements.
-
Initiating an active role in marketing our firm services resulting in new business.
-
Continuously fostering relationships with coworkers and clients.
-
Traveling 20-25% of the time.
Qualifications:
-
Developed specialties in Manufacturing & Distribution and Consumer Products.
-
5-year bachelor’s degree in accounting.
-
Master’s degree preferred.
-
Licensed CPA.
-
5+ years of experience working for a public accounting firm.
-
Energetically managing, coaching, and developing staff accountants.
-
Analytical skills in relation to financial statements and other financial information.
-
Effective written and verbal communication skills with clients and co-workers.
-
Demonstrating initiative and willingness to lead, make decisions, and work independently.

Perks/Benefits we offer for full-time team members:
-
Medical, Dental, and Vision Insurance on the first day of employment
-
Flexible Spending Account and Dependent Care Account
-
401k with Profit Sharing
-
9+ holidays and discretionary time off structure
-
Parental Leave – coverage for both primary and secondary caregivers
-
Tuition Assistance Program and CPA support program with cash incentive upon completion
-
Discretionary incentive compensation based on firm, group and individual performance
-
Incentive compensation related to origination of new client sales
-
Top rated wellness program
-
Flexible working environment including remote and hybrid options
